Self-employed (Professional card)

All non-Belgians wishing to exercise a self-employed professional activity, either as natural persons or within an association or a partnership in fact or in law, must be holders of a professional card. Professional cards may be obtained from the region you are planning to base your activity in (Flanders, Wallonia, Brussels-Capital).

Application for a professional card can be done at the Belgian Office, Taipei

Once you have obtained your professional card, please bring the following documents for the issuance of your visa:

  • A copy of the decision to grant the professional card
  • Fill the application form online via VOW , print out 2 copies and duly signed and dated. On each form a passport size photograph must be affixed.    
  • Make an online reservation on VOW
  • A valid passport (more than 12 months) 
  • Proof of payment of the administrative fee (please click here for explanation)
  • A copy of your ARC if you are a foreigner.
  • A medical certificate filled out by the hospital approved by the Belgian Office in Taipei stating that the applicant is not suffering from a disease that may endanger public health (hospital).
  • An authenticated criminal record if you are aged over 18.
